At their core, resilient channels are designed to decouple drywall from the framing of a building. Imagine a classic see-saw—a little wiggle here or there makes all the difference in how the board shifts. Resilient channels work on that principle. By separating the drywall from the structural elements, they effectively minimize the transmission of sound waves. This decoupling isn't just a fancy term; it's a fundamental acoustic engineering practice aimed at reducing noise pollution in spaces like multi-family housing or commercial environments.

Finally, let’s get into some technicalities. The way sound travels is akin to a game of telephone; it hops from one element to another. With resilient channels in place, you're introducing a flexible connection that dampens vibrations. Think of it as a cushion for sound waves, absorbing unwanted noise that would otherwise find its way through and disrupt your tranquil environment.
